    Princess Cruises Reveals Epic 2026 Alaska Season
    Princess Cruises, the leading cruise line in Alaska, today unveiled its biggest-ever Alaska season for 2026, highlighted by the debut of the newest ship in its fleet, Star Princess. The exciting, expanded Alaska programme for 2026 features eight ships, 180 departures, and 19 destinations, providing travellers with an unparalleled selection of Alaska adventures by sea, or by both land and sea. For the first time, guests will have the opportunity to explore Alaska aboard a Sphere Class ship as Star Princess sails her first summer season in the Great Land, offering unparalleled views of glaciers and wildlife. As the second ship in the Sphere Class following Sun Princess, Star Princess launches in autumn 2025 and promises an elevated cruising experience. A true engineering marvel and a global citizen, this ship features innovative architectural spectacles like The Dome, the industry's first geodesic structure, and The Sphere, a suspended glass Piazza. Additionally, it is celebrated, along with sister ship Sun Princess, as the greatest foodie destination at sea, promising to tantalise taste buds with world-class culinary offerings.   • Carnival Corporation Orders Three Additional Ships for Carnival Cruise Line
    With consumer demand for cruise vacations at historic levels,Carnival Corporation &plc(NYSE/LSE: CCL; NYSE: CUK), the world's largest cruise company, today announced an order for three new ships for its namesake Carnival Cruise Line brand for a new class of vessel, at nearly 230,000 gross registered tonnes. The agreement with Italian shipbuilder Fincantieri provides for the design, engineering, and construction of these liquefied natural gas (LNG)-powered ships, which will be delivered in the summers of 2029, 2031 and 2033, respectively. "We are proud to be known as America's cruise line with tremendous guest loyalty and an outstanding team that has enabled us to deliver memorable vacations to over 100 million guests," saidChristine Duffy, president ofCarnival Cruise Line. "For this next generation ship, we are focused on creating innovative guest experiences that will takeCarnival Cruise Lineinto the future with new FUN features and excitement that we know our guests will LOVE." With today's order, there have been five new ship orders forCarnival Cruise Lineannounced in 2024. Earlier this year,Carnival Corporationplaced its first newbuild orders in five years for two more Excel-class ships that will join theCarnival Cruise Linefleet in 2027 and 2028. The company also recently announced a series of strategic shifts to further optimize the composition of its global brand portfolio and to increase guest capacity forCarnival Cruise Line, transferring a total of five vessels from sister brands to theCarnival Cruise Linefleet between 2023 andMarch 2025. "We are doubling down on the growth ofCarnival Cruise Line– our highest-returning brand – to keep up with the incredibly strong demand we continue to see for the world's most popular cruise line," saidJosh Weinstein, chief executive officer ofCarnival Corporation &plc. "At this point, our newbuild pipeline is just one delivery in each of 2025, 2027, 2028, 2029, 2031 and 2033. We continue to take a disciplined approach to growth, strategically directing new capacity to the areas of highest demand at a rate of one to two new ships per year." According to Weinstein, this order will take the company's overall measured capacity growth between 2025 and 2033 to an average of approximately 1.5% per year. "This gives us the headroom to strategically provide new capacity to the brands in our portfolio likeCarnival Cruise Line, which provide outsized returns while continuing to execute against our responsible capital strategy, using our strong free cash flow over the next several years to improve our balance sheet, significantly reduce our debt, and continue to transfer value from debt holders to shareholders," he said. With over 3,000 guest staterooms, the new ships will be the largest in theCarnival Corporationglobal fleet and will be able to deliver fun to more guests than any ship in the world when carrying almost 8,000 guests at full capacity. Once delivered in 2033,Carnival Corporationwill have a total of 16 LNG-powered ships – including eightCarnival Cruise Lineships – making up almost 30% ofCarnival Corporation'sglobal capacity and delivering immediate greenhouse gas emission reductions. The new ships will also feature advanced energy efficiency, waste management, and emission reduction technologies to further reduce the company's environmental footprint. "We are excited to join forces withCarnival Cruise Lineto debut a new class of ship, which will be the largest cruise ship ever constructed by Fincantieri and the largest ship ever built inItaly. We are proud of the role Fincantieri has played in helpingCarnival Corporationsecure its position as the world's largest cruise company and look forward to continuing this success story together," said Pierroberto Folgiero, CEO, Fincantieri. Design details and itinerary information for the newCarnival Cruise Lineships will be announced in the future. This order is contingent upon financing, which is expected to be completed later this year. 24 July, 2024

  • VIVA Cruises enhances trade support with Traveltek partnership
    VIVA Cruises has moved to bolster its distribution through the UK trade by partnering with travel technology provider Traveltek. Through the new partnership, agents will now have access to flat file pricing, itineraries, and ship content for the cruise line’s nine ships which operate across seven rivers. VIVA’s fleet includes own-build shipsVIVA ONEandVIVA TWO,with its third,VIVA ENJOY, in the pipeline. The line also recently announced new Douro itineraries will take place onboard new shipPorto Mirantefrom May 2025. Traveltek currently offers access to more than 300 suppliers across the aviation, accommodation, cruise, payment and ancillaries sectors. Tracy Sharp, Global Director of Revenue and Supply at Traveltek, said: “I am delighted to announce that VIVA Cruises has chosen to partner with Traveltek as an important addition to its cruise product offering and part of our river cruise portfolio expansion. This partnership will benefit our customers who are responding to the surge in demand in European river cruises.” Patrick Ell, Director Marketing and Digital for VIVA Cruises, added: “We are very excited about our collaboration with Traveltek. By adding our river cruise itineraries into the Traveltek platform, VIVA Cruises is expanding its reach and providing travel agents with a new premium river cruise experience for their customers, who will appreciate the relaxed atmosphere and the varied itineraries on offer.” 22 July, 2024

    Seabourn announces immersive Image Masters Photography Programme on select Expedition Voyages
    Seabourn, the leader in ultra-luxury voyages and expedition travel, is introducing ‘Image Masters,’ a new hands-on programme designed to sharpen the camerawork of guests via intimate photography masterclasses available on select Seabourn expedition voyages. Launching in August 2024, the new hands-on programme will provide in-the-field instruction on photo composition, camera technique, editing, and retouching all led by an accomplished nature photographer. Imagine capturing the moment when a colony of penguins jump out of the water in Antarctica; when humpback whales breach in the Arctic; or when a Scarlet Macaw in the Amazon rainforest spreads its wings. ‘Having a sharp eye for photography when surrounded by natural wonders in remote regions of the world is an extraordinary way to capture the moment, and our new Image Masters programmewill teach guests how to best photograph the incredible landscapes and wildlife seen on our expedition voyages’, said Robin West, Seabourn’s Vice President and General Manager, Expedition Operations and Planning. ‘Like every element of the Seabourn experience, Image Masters is designed for guests to enjoy their time with us to the fullest and share it when they return home’ Image Masters will be offered on select sailings of Seabourn’s new purpose-built expedition ships, Seabourn Ventureand Seabourn Pursuit. Space will be limited with just 10 guests eligible to join the photography-focused programme for the duration of their voyage. Participating guests will enjoy priority access to the onboard photographer, curated outings both onboard and ashore, and priority access to the Photo Studio, as well as participation in lively programming designed to polish their photography skills, including: Photographer-Led Zodiac Tours and Walks -Guests can join the Image Masters each time the ship has a Zodiac® or walking tour, hosted by the group’s dedicated Seabourn photographer. The tours include stops for capturing photographs and discussing techniques. This is a hands-on learning experience where guests can apply the knowledge gained from onboard lectures and workshops. Exclusive Lectures and Workshops - Each voyage will host at least three lectures that will dive deep into topics like camera setup, composition, lighting, storytelling and post-processing, in addition to important tips about the specific regions guests will be photographing. 1:1 Mentoring and Coaching Sessions -Guests can sign up for 30-minute slots of individual time with the onboard photographer to discuss personalised topics, receive photo critiques, get editing assistance or even shoot together onboard. Private photo studio Hours with Lightroom Access for Enrolled Guests Only- Guests will collaborate directly with the photographer on editing and receive personalised feedback. The photo studio will be reserved solely for participants during these sessions. Photographer Hosted Dinner- This exclusive meal gives guests time to reflect and build enriching connections within their group. It is more than just a dinner, it’s a chance to be part of a community of photography enthusiasts, sharing insights, stories, and the joy of capturing the world through a lens. Guests enrolled in Image Masters will leave with an enhanced understanding of basic photography principles, editing expertise, a new community of fellow photographers, and professional-level photos from their trip. Seabourn will roll out the new Image Masters programmeon Seabourn Venture’s11-Day Fjords of East Greenland voyage, departing 5th August 2024. Cost for the program starts from £1,560 ($2,000) per participant (costs vary based on itinerary and location). 22 July, 2024

    Norwegian Cruise Line announces Philadelphia as a new homeport with its 2026 Spring Summer Season
    Norwegian Cruise Line (NCL), the innovator in global cruise travel with a 57-year history of breaking boundaries, today announced its 2026 spring/summer itineraries to the Caribbean, Bahamas, Bermuda, Alaska, and Canada and New England, as well as a new season of voyages from the Port of Philadelphia (PhilaPort) for the first time in many years. On 16th April, 2026, Norwegian Jewel® will commence seven-to-nine-day cruises to Bermuda, launching the city as a new cruise destination. Departing from the SouthPort Marine Terminal Complex, where plans are currently underway with the local government to develop a facility to welcome cruisers in 2026, Norwegian Jewel’s Bermuda itineraries will feature overnight calls to Royal Naval Dockyard, Bermuda, providing guests more time to enjoy and discover the island’s turquoise blue waters and pink-sand beaches. “We remain committed to delivering more experiences for our guests to create unforgettable memories, so they can vacation better with us,” said David J. Herrera, president of Norwegian Cruise Line. “We are particularly proud to partner with PhilaPort to launch cruising in the area, making it even more accessible to the U.S. Mid-Atlantic region.” “The Port of Philadelphia is extremely excited to partner with Norwegian Cruise Line, one of the world’s premier cruise lines,” said Jeff Theobald, executive director and CEO of PhilaPort. “Philadelphia has so much to offer, as the birthplace of freedom and the home to much of our nation’s history, we look forward to connecting cruisers with our world class city. This new service rounds out the portfolio of services offered at PhilaPort, and we look forward to this next phase of growth.” The Company’s new 2026 spring/summer season includes nearly 250 itineraries for nine of its soon-to-be 20 ships. Embarking from U.S. and Canadian ports between April and November 2026, these voyages will call to 30 unique destinations across the Caribbean, Bermuda, Bahamas, Canada and New England, as well as Alaska. With an average of 10 hours in port, guests can choose to enjoy the picture-perfect beaches, colourful cities and vibrant culture of the Caribbean, Bahamas and Bermuda; enjoy the rustic fall foliage of Canada and New England; or dive deep into the pristine nature and abundant wilderness found in Alaska. Herrera continued, “Our new 2026 spring/summer deployment further meets the vacation demands of our guests with more shorter cruise offerings to fun-in-the-sun destinations, such as the Bahamas and the Caribbean, as well as a variety of longer itineraries to bucket list destinations, such as Alaska.” 22 July, 2024

    Disney and Oriental Land Co Ltd to launch Disney Cruise Holidays in Japan
    Disney and Oriental Land Co., Ltd. (OLC) announced a new agreement that will bring year-round Disney cruise holidays to Japan. Under a recently signed agreement, OLC will operate a Disney-branded cruise business in Japan, expected to commence by early 2029. This is the latest evolution in an over 40-year relationship between Disney and OLC, which owns and operates Tokyo Disney Resort. The addition of a locally based Disney cruise ship will offer fun and relaxation for Japanese Disney fans and visitors from around the world during magical voyages filled with the incredible entertainment, world-class dining and exceptional guest service that set Disney cruises apart. “Disney Cruise Line has ambitious plans to bring family vacations and Disney storytelling to more guests around the world than ever before,” said Josh D’Amaro, chairman, Disney Experiences. “We are thrilled to continue the success of this expansion as we collaborate with Oriental Land Co. to introduce another distinctly Disney vacation experience to families and fans in Japan.” “I am sincerely proud that Disney and Oriental Land will be able to work together to create a world-class cruise business in Japan,” said Yumiko Takano, representative director, chairperson and CEO, Oriental Land. “Oriental Land will use their knowhow from the theme park business to continue pushing boundaries and provide family entertainment cruise experiences filled with inspiration and surprise.” OLC will operate a new Disney cruise ship to be registered and based in Japan year-round. The ship will be constructed at Meyer Werft shipyard in Papenburg, Germany, with imaginative designs created by Walt Disney Imagineering. A sister ship to the popular Disney Wish, it will feature many guest-favourite venues and experiences from that ship with select modifications specially designed with Japanese guests in mind. It is expected to be approximately 140,000 gross tons and powered by liquefied natural gas, with about 1,250 staterooms. More details about the maiden voyage, itineraries and onboard experiences will be announced at a later date. The Disney Cruise Line fleet sails to world-class destinations in The Bahamas, the Caribbean, Europe, Alaska, Mexico, Canada, Hawaii, the South Pacific, and Australia and New Zealand, and year-round cruises from Singapore are planned to begin in 2025. 22 July, 2024
